Certificate Program in Business Administration & Professional English (BPE)

Two semesters (one academic year):
August 31, 2009 to May 14, 2010*
Application deadline: July 17, 2009

The BPE certificate program is designed for international students who are non-native speakers of English.  BPE certificate students are interested in developing an advanced level of English for business and professional purposes, and in learning the basics of American business practices. A university degree and minimum TOEFL score of 70 IBT/195 CBT/525 PBT are required for admission to this program.

The Fall semester of this two semester program includes a 20-hour per week English for Professional Purposes course and two Business Administration courses, Principles of Management and Principles of Marketing. The Spring semester includes an English for Specific Business Purposes course which meets an average of 18 hours per week, and three Business Administration courses, Business Accounting, Business Financial Management, and Business Policy. All Business Administration Courses are taken jointly with American students at Georgetown University. Faculty members in the Certificate Program are full-time, experienced professors from the Georgetown University English as a Foreign Language Intensive Program and the McDonough School of Business.
